Pyroelectric infrared flame sensors, leveraging the pyroelectric effect to convert temperature fluctuations into electrical signals, provide highly reliable flame detection across a wide temperature range. Their fast response time, low power consumption, and resistance to electromagnetic interference make them indispensable in environments where safety and precision are paramount. Industries ranging from oil & gas to aerospace increasingly adopt these sensors to mitigate fire risk and meet stringent regulatory standards.

Emerging Opportunities in EV Battery Safety and Renewable Energy

Beyond traditional safety drivers, the report highlights two high‑growth avenues. First, the rapid scaling of electric‑vehicle (EV) battery production has created a demand for flame sensors capable of detecting thermal runaway events within tightly packed cell modules. Second, the expanding portfolio of renewable‑energy installations-particularly solar‑thermal plants and hydrogen‑fuel facilities-requires sensors that can operate reliably under high‑temperature, high‑radiation conditions. Both segments are projected to contribute an incremental 15% to total market volume by 2030.

In addition, the convergence of Industry 4.0 and safety management is reshaping the sensor landscape. Smart flame sensors equipped with edge‑computing capabilities can perform local signal processing, transmit real‑time alerts to central control rooms, and trigger automated shutdown procedures without human intervention. According to the study, adoption of such IoT‑enabled sensors can cut incident‑response times by up to 55% and lower overall safety‑related operational costs by approximately 22%.

Regional Dynamics and Outlook

Asia‑Pacific remains the dominant region, accounting for roughly 71% of global shipments in 2024. China, Japan, South Korea, and India collectively drive demand through large‑scale infrastructure projects, aggressive renewable‑energy targets, and expanding petrochemical complexes. The Middle East follows as the second‑largest market, powered by substantial investments in offshore gas processing and oil‑field automation.

North America and Europe together represent about 22% of the market, with the United States leading in advanced fire‑safety regulations and the European Union emphasizing stringent Environmental, Health, and Safety (EHS) directives. Both regions exhibit a steady shift toward IoT‑enabled safety solutions, supported by governmental incentives for digital transformation in industrial safety.

Latin America and Africa, while currently smaller contributors, are projected to experience double‑digit CAGR over the forecast horizon, driven by rising industrialization, urbanization, and the advent of new safety codes in emerging economies.
